Processed Meat refers to meat that has been processed in some way other than grinding and cutting, such as meat that is seasoned or cured and then cooked, smoked or dried. These are usually found in the deli aisle of your local supermarket.
Processed meats generally lose quality quickly and should be used as soon as possible (before the date on the package).
Product |
Refrigerator (Days at 40°F) |
Freezer (Months at 0°F) |
| Beef or Pork | ||
| Bacon | 7 | 1 |
| Ham | ||
| Whole | 7 | 1 - 2 |
| Half | 3 -5 | 1 - 2 |
| Slices | 3 -4 | 1 - 2 |
| Luncheon Meats | ||
| Frankfurters | 1 - 2 | 3 - 4 |
| Lunch Meat | 3 - 5 | 1 - 2 |
| Sausage | ||
| Dry | 14 - 21 | 1 - 2 |
| Smoked | 7 | 1 - 2 |
